V7 AND V9 BANDS OF FORMIC-ACID NEAR 16-MU-M

The ν7 and ν9 fundamental bands of formic acid were studied by Fourier transform spectroscopy with a resolving power of 0.020 cm-1. Band centers obtained are ν7 = 626.158 cm-1 and ν9 = 640.722 cm-1. It was possible to determine rotational and centrifugal distortion parameters for both vibrational states v7 = 1 and v9 = 1 and also the two first-order Coriolis interaction parameters along z and x axes and the second-order Coriolis parameter along z axis. The stability of rotational and distortion parameters compared to ground state values confirms that a Watson type Hamiltonian is well adapted to such a problem. © 1979.
